Meenmutty Falls has long been a part of the local landscape and folklore. While there isn't extensive documented history, the falls have been a significant natural feature in the Wayanad region for centuries. The indigenous communities likely revered the falls and the surrounding forests. Over time, as Wayanad became more accessible, Meenmutty Falls gained recognition as a tourist destination. Its natural beauty and the challenging trek required to reach it have added to its allure. Today, the falls are a protected area, and efforts are made to preserve the natural ecosystem surrounding them.
Amazing falls. Entry fee is Rs. 50 per head. This waterfall has awesome view from the top. The water looks very clean. Worth spending half a day here.
I went in November 2024, Entering the water is fully permitted (may change with season), well maintained with guards as well. Parking area is available near ticket counter. Rs. 65 for adults.
Temporarily closed due to on going incidents of wild animals attacking people of wynad district. The road towards the parking area is closed for work. Otherwise the approach road is very narrow and the parking area is not so big. The view towards the place is beautiful with tea plantations on both sides. There is another view point close to this place. Best time to visit would be during or immediately after monsoon. Entry fee - Adult 50, Child 30 Rs
